Juan wants to make a new game board that is a grid containing 25 equally sized squares. How many squares should be shaded to cre
ate a region with a geometric probability of 0.2? Explain.
2 answers:
Let the number of shaded square be x. And it is given that total number of squares are 25.

Substituting the values

Performing cross multiplication

So 5 squares should be shaded to create a region with a geometric probability of 0.2 .
